Overview Venset 37.5mg Tablet

Deprexis 37.5mg tablets effectively manage depressive and anxiety disorders. This medication modifies brain chemistry, alleviating symptoms like agitation, unease, poor concentration, tiredness, perspiration, rapid heartbeat, and racing thoughts. Take Deprexis 37.5mg with food, consistently at the same time daily for optimal blood levels. If a dose is missed, take it immediately upon recollection. Complete the prescribed course, even if feeling improved; abruptly ceasing treatment can exacerbate symptoms. Common side effects—nausea, vomiting, sleep disturbances, reduced appetite, anxiety, constipation, increased sweating, and sexual difficulties—are usually temporary. Dizziness and drowsiness may occur; avoid driving or mentally demanding tasks until effects are known. Consult your doctor if side effects persist or are troublesome. Prior to commencing Deprexis 37.5mg, disclose any kidney, heart, liver issues, or history of seizures. Report any unusual mood shifts, worsening depression, or suicidal ideation to your physician.

How Venset 37.5mg Tablet works:

Venset 37.5mg tablets elevate brain levels of serotonin and noradrenaline, neurotransmitters crucial for emotional equilibrium.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holUNSAFE

Avoid alcohol while taking Venset 37.5mg tablets.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Using Venset 37.5m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to the unborn child.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to prescription. Seek medical advice before taking this medication.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Venset 37.5mg T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icate potential transfer to breast milk, posing a risk to the infant. Close observation of infants for drowsiness and satisfactory weight increase is recommended.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Driving ability may be impaired by Venset 37.5mg Tablet side effects. These include dizziness, confusion, and visual disturbances like blurred vision, all of which can impact driving safety.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should use Venset 37.5mg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ring a modified dosage. Physician consultation is advised.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should use Venset 37.5mg tablets c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. A physician's consultation is advised.

What if you forget to take Venset 37.5mg Tablet :

Should you forget a Venset 37.5mg Tablet dose, administer it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on Venset 37.5mg Tablet

Sedation is a possible side effect of Venset 37.5mg Tablets. Disclose any other sleep aids you're using to your doctor before starting this medication.
Yes. Venset 37.5mg tablets are psychotropic medications; these affect the mind, emotions, and behavior.
Venset 37.5mg Tablets are not narcotics. Narcotics are opioid-derived drugs, such as heroin and morphine, that induce sleep.
Venset 37.5mg tablets, in both ER and XR formulations, are the same medication. Both are extended-release, providing a slow, steady medication release and maintaining consistent therapeutic levels. Extended-release formulations reduce the frequency of dosing.
Mirtazapine and Venset 37.5mg tablets together pose a serious risk of serotonin syndrome, a potentially life-threatening condition. Symptoms may include agitation, hallucinations,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, rapid heart rate, fluctuating blood pressure, high fever, and coma.
Combining citalopram and Venset 37.5mg tablets elevates serotonin levels, risking serotonin syndrome—a potentially fatal condition. Symptoms include agitation, hallucinations,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, rapid heart rate, fluctuating blood pressure, high fever, and coma. Alternative medications should be considered.
P-glycoprotein pumps Venset 37.5mg Tablet out of the brain. However, some research indicates that Venset 37.5mg Tablet and its metabolite can inhibit p-glycoprotein activity.
Venset 37.5mg tablets are absorbed into the body from the intestines following hepatic metabolism.
Venset 37.5mg tablets treat generalized depressive disorder. Always consult a doctor before use.
Some individuals taking Venset 37.5mg Tablets experience sustained blood pressure increases. Regular blood pressure monitoring is recommended for these patients, with potential dose reduction or treatment discontinuation as needed.
Constipation is a known side effect of Venset 37.5mg tablets in some individuals. Increase your fiber intake and fluid consumption. Laxatives may also be helpful. Your physician can advise on prevention and management. Consult your doctor if constipation persists or worsens.
Yes, Venset 37.5mg tablets have been associated with weight loss in some patients. Studies show this effect increases with dosage and prolonged use. Consult your doctor if this concerns you.
Venset 37.5mg Tablets are not habit-forming.
While a tablet may be substituted for a capsule, this should only occur with a doctor's explicit guidance. Altering your medication independently is unsafe, as differing formulations can impact drug release and efficacy, potentially causing adverse reactions or treatment failure.
Gabapentin can be combined with Venset 37.5mg tablets, but only under a doctor's supervision. Concurrent use may increase drowsiness, sleepiness, and impair concentration. Exercise caution.
Desvenlafaxine is the active form of the medication found in Venset 37.5mg Tablet.
Venset 37.5mg Tablets haven't received approval for fibromyalgia treatment, although some studies suggest potential benefits. Always consult your doctor before using this medication for fibromyalgia.
While not FDA-approved for nerve pain, Venset 37.5mg tablets have shown efficacy in some research studies and are consequently used off-label for this purpose.
Venset 37.5mg tablets alter brain neurotransmitter levels, resulting in a dose-dependent decrease in appetite.
Experience decreased sex drive or impotence? Consult your doctor; alternative medications may be available. Do not discontinue Venset 37.5mg Tablet without medical supervision, as this may worsen side effects.
